I love making an easy traybake and this baked oaty slice is a good one! So easy to make, it’s like a cross between a flapjack, a cookie and a cake. It’s really moreish and something the kids love for breakfast, in their lunch boxes or as a sweet treat after school.
Put all the dry ingredients in a large mixing bowl and mix until well combined.
Add the melted butter, egg, vanilla and golden syrup and mix well.
Add in the flavourings and mix well.
Pour the mixture into the prepared tin and smooth with a spatula to create a level bake.
Bake in the middle of the oven for 20 minutes until slightly risen and nicely golden brown on the top. Leave to cool completely in the tin before cutting into slices.
